UniApp中的第三方SDK集成与使用
发布时间: 2024-03-15 17:45:03 阅读量: 282 订阅数: 37 


安卓第三方登录分享集成SDK
# 1. 介绍UniApp
## 1.1 什么是UniApp
UniApp是一款基于Vue.js开发的跨平台应用开发框架,可以通过一套代码同时生成iOS和Android版本的应用,甚至还支持H5和快应用。开发者可以利用UniApp进行快速开发,并在不同平台上部署应用,提高开发效率。
## 1.2 UniApp的优势与劣势
### 优势:
- 跨平台:一套代码多端运行
- 基于Vue.js:易学易用
- 支持原生插件扩展:丰富的生态系统
### 劣势:
- 性能稍逊于原生应用
- 受限于原生平台的功能扩展
## 1.3 UniApp支持的第三方SDK种类
UniApp支持的第三方SDK种类繁多,涵盖了多个领域,包括但不限于:
- 社交分享类SDK(如微信SDK、QQSDK)
- 数据统计分析类SDK(如友盟统计SDK)
- 支付类SDK(如支付宝SDK、微信支付SDK)
- 地图定位类SDK(如百度地图SDK、高德地图SDK)
- 广告推广类SDK(如广点通SDK、穿山甲SDK)
在UniApp项目中集成这些第三方SDK,可以为应用添加丰富的功能和服务,提高用户体验和应用价值。
# 2. 选择适合的第三方SDK
在整合第三方SDK到UniApp项目中之前,首先需要评估项目的需求,选择适合的SDK。本章将介绍如何选择合适的第三方SDK,包括评估项目需求、搜索与筛选可用的SDK以及考虑与UniApp的兼容性。
### 2.1 评估项目需求
在选择第三方SDK之前,需要明确项目的功能需求,确定需要集成的功能模块。例如,如果项目需要实现地图功能,可以考虑集成地图SDK;如果需要实现社交分享功能,可以选择社交分享SDK等。
### 2.2 搜索与筛选可用的第三方SDK
一旦确定项目需求,可以通过搜索引擎、开发者社区、应用商店等途径寻找适合的第三方SDK。在搜索和筛选过程中,可以参考SDK的文档、用户评价、功能特点等信息,选择适合项目需求的SDK。
### 2.3 考虑与UniApp的兼容性
在选择第三方SDK时,需要考虑其与UniApp的兼容性。一些SDK可能不支持UniApp的环境或需要额外适配才能在UniApp中正常使用。因此,在选择SDK时,需要确认其是否支持UniApp,并注意查阅相关的集成文档和注意事项。
通过评估项目需求、筛选可用的SDK以及考虑与UniApp的兼容性,可以选择合适的第三方SDK,并为后续的集成工作奠定基础。
# 3. 集成第三方SDK到UniApp项目中
在UniApp项目中集成第三方SDK是为了扩展项目的功能和服务,但在进行集成时需要一些细节和步骤。本章将介绍如何将第三方SDK集成到UniApp项目中,确保SDK的正确使用。
#### 3.1 SDK获取与注册
在集成第三方SDK之前,首先需要获取SDK的相关信息以及注册开发者账号。通常情况下,开发者需要在第三方SDK官方网站注册账号并创建应用,以获取SDK的AppKey、AppSecret等信息。
#### 3.2 UniApp项目配置
在开始集成SDK
0
0
相关推荐






